Laminate Floor Water Extraction Cost in Geronimo Estates, AZ
Prices for Laminate Floor Water Extraction services vary based on severity, size of affected area, and local conditions in Geronimo Estates, AZ. These estimates are not guarantees, and ex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. Free estimates are available contact us today to schedule yours.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, equipment used, and time required |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ment used, and time required |
| Inspection and Repairs |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and materials needed |
| More Equipment or Labor |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, equipment used, and time required |
